Ordinals
testnet4
Sat 1510207823123291
decimal
394083.323123291
degree
0°184083′963″323123291‴
percentile
71.9146583230724%
name
ddpgzxiyyuw
cycle
0
epoch
1
period
195
block
394083
offset
323123291
timestamp
2031-04-20 21:13:38 UTC
(expected)
rarity
common
prev
next